3. What does chuck noland Find on the Dead Air Plane Pilot?

Arts
1 answer:
aliina [53]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

Over the next few days, several FedEx packages also wash up ashore, as well as the corpse of one of the FedEx pilots, whom Chuck buries. Chuck tries to signal a passing ship and escape in the damaged life raft, but the incoming surf tosses him onto a coral reef, injuring his leg. He is able to find sufficient food, water, and shelter

What composer achieved innovations in orchestratio and tonality that are often called impressionism in music?
-Dominant- [34]
Claude Debussy was a French composer who was born on August 22, 1862. He was one of the prominent personality associated with Impressionism in music. One of his famous works include Prélude à l’après-midi d’un faune<span> (1894; </span>Prelude to the Afternoon of a Faun) and La Mer <span>(1905; “The Sea”).</span>

Culinary- Why is it hard to know when a steamed item has finished cooking?​
Butoxors [25]

Answer:

It's harder to know when a steamed item has finished cooking because it generally does not change in color or shape.
